The Arizona mechanic form az with private pool, formally known as the Preliminary Twenty Day Notice, serves as a critical legal document designed to inform property owners of potential liens associated with construction services or materials. This form adheres to Arizona Revised Statutes section 33-992.01 and is essential for contractors, subcontractors, and suppliers to protect their rights to payment. Key features include sections for identifying the involved parties, the nature of the work or services provided, and an estimate of the total cost along with acknowledgment of receipt requirements. Users must complete each section accurately, and it is crucial to ensure that the notice is mailed correctly to the relevant parties within the specified time frame. Under state law, a swimming pool (or other contained body of water intended for swimming that is 18 inches deep and wider than eight feet) must be entirely enclosed by at least a five-foot wall, fence or other barrier. The enclosure requirement applies to below-ground and above-ground pools alike.

The Arizona Swimming Pools (A-9) Contractor License allows you to do the following work: Build and repair swimming pools and spas. Water and gas lines from point of service to pool equipment. Wiring from disconnect to pool equipment. Pool piping. Fittings. Backflow prevention devices. Waste lines.

If your business includes repairs, maintenance, and upgrades on pools, you will need a contractor's license in Arizona.
